Common Zero Zone parts technicians replace

Zero Zone fitment checklist

  • Match the model and serial plate to the case or door section being repaired.
  • Confirm voltage, wattage, RPM, lead style, shaft direction, and mounting before ordering electrical parts.
  • Measure heater length, gasket profile, hinge offset, and latch orientation on the installed part.
  • Use OEM numbers, cross-reference numbers, and photos together instead of relying on appearance alone.

Zero Zone parts FAQ

How do I confirm a Zero Zone fan motor or heater?
Verify the OEM number, voltage, wattage or RPM, lead style, mounting, and the exact section of equipment before ordering.

What usually fixes a Zero Zone door that will not self-close?
Check the torque rod, torque master, hinges, latch alignment, and gasket seal together before replacing only one part.

What To Check Before Ordering

  • Equipment brand, model number, and serial plate information
  • Old part number or manufacturer number when available
  • Dimensions, mounting holes, profile, connector, voltage, or handedness
  • Photos of the installed part from the front, side, label, and mounting area
  • Related parts such as gaskets, hinges, latches, heaters, handles, sensors, and controls

Common Commercial Refrigeration Problems

These parts are commonly inspected when technicians troubleshoot door sealing, frost, temperature, airflow, moisture, and hardware problems.

  • Door not sealing, sagging, dragging, or popping open
  • Frost, condensation, or sweating around door openings
  • Warm cabinet temperatures or slow temperature recovery
  • Ice buildup, failed heaters, weak airflow, or damaged hardware
